              HOUSE SPECIAL COMMITTEE ON FISHERIES                             
                         April 19, 1996                                        
                           9:55 a.m.                                           
                                                                               
                                                                               
 MEMBERS PRESENT                                                               
                                                                               
 Representative Alan Austerman, Chairman                                       
 Representative Carl Moses, Vice Chairman                                      
 Representative Scott Ogan                                                     
 Representative Gary Davis                                                     
 Representative Kim Elton                                                      
                                                                               
 MEMBERS ABSENT                                                                
                                                                               
 All members were present.                                                     
                                                                               
 COMMITTEE CALENDAR                                                            
                                                                               
 GOVERNOR'S APPOINTMENTS TO BOARD OF FISHERIES:  GRANT MILLER, DAN             
 COFFEY AND VIRGIL UMPHENOUR                                                   
                                                                               
 PREVIOUS ACTION                                                               
                                                                               
 Hearing continued from April 18, 1996.                                        
                                                                               
 WITNESS REGISTER                                                              
                                                                               
 None.                                                                         
                                                                               
 ACTION NARRATIVE                                                              
                                                                               
 TAPE 96-20, SIDE A                                                            
 Number 0001                                                                   
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N ALAN AUSTERMAN reconvened the House Special Committee on             
 Fisheries meeting at 9:55 a.m.  All members were present at the               
 call to order.                                                                
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N noted there was a motion on the floor by                   
 Representative Elton the previous day that Chairman Austerman had             
 ruled out of order.  In checking with Legislative Legal Services,             
 he found that Representative Elton's motion was correct.  He asked            
 Representative Elton to restate the motion.                                   
                                                                               
 Number 0016                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E KIM ELTON moved that the name of Virgil Umphenour be           
 reported out of committee with a recommendation to confirm him to             
 the Board of Fisheries.  He recommended a "no" vote.                          
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S objected and said he preferred the standard              
 motion.  "I think they should go the full board unbiased and have             
 discussion on the floor," he said.                                            
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E CARL MOSES asked why, if there were no                         
 recommendations submitted, the committee holds these confirmation             
 hearings.                                                                     
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S said there was discussion at the joint                   
 session.  He indicated committee minutes were also available.                 
                                                                               
 Number 0060                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E MOSES stated, "Normally, I take the attitude of, no            
 matter who's governor, I'm inclined to go along with his                      
 appointments, because he has to live with them, work with them and            
 defend them.  In the particular case of Virgil Umphenour, he                  
 borderline outright lied to me last night, and I don't appreciate             
 it.  I have people that would give a deposition as to what he has             
 been saying.  And he has a personal vendetta and is not a good                
 board member with the attitude he has and his personal agenda on              
 that board.  So, I'd like to go on record ... that he not be                  
 confirmed."                                                                   
                                                                               
 Number 0079                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ON indicated agreement for different reasons.               
 The committee had heard testimony from both board members and the             
 public, and he thought it was important to indicate opinions on               
 potential members, especially for someone serving in one of the               
 more important posts.  One reason he decided to go this route                 
 rather than the standard one, he said, was because of a                       
 confirmation the previous year, when he would have liked to have              
 known the thoughts of the committee that heard testimony.  This               
 method also allowed committee members to explain their reasons in             
 committee, without having to do so on the floor.                              
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N asked for a roll call vote.                                
                                                                               
 Number 0112                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N asked if three members voted no, whether that             
 meant Virgil Umphenour's name was not passed out of committee.                
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N explained, "If you don't feel you want to send             
 a message ... or pass out of here that we're confirming Virgil,               
 then you would vote no.  If you want to pass this out with a                  
 positive vote that you want to confirm Virgil, you vote yes."                 
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N asked if Mr. Umphenour's name would be on the             
 floor for confirmation, regardless of the outcome.                            
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N affirmed that.                                             
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N said he would abstain.                                    
                                                                               
 Voting against the motion to recommend confirmation of Virgil                 
 Umphenour were Representatives Elton, Davis, Moses and Austerman.             
 Voting for it, after all, was Representative Ogan.  So, the motion            
 failed, 4-1.                                                                  
                                                                               
 Number 0138                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ON moved that the name of Grant Miller be                   
 reported out of committee with a recommendation that he be                    
 confirmed to the Board of Fisheries.                                          
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S objected.                                                
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N clarified that the motion regarding Virgil                 
 Umphenour would be called Motion 1, with the motion regarding Grant           
 Miller being Motion 2.                                                        
                                                                               
 Number 0152                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S stated his preference to have a standard                 
 motion.                                                                       
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N asked whether, if not recommended, the name               
 would still be forwarded and asked if he could abstain from voting.           
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N indicated the latter was up to Representative              
 Ogan.  He asked if there was further discussion.                              
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S withdrew his objection.                                  
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N asked if there was further objection.  There               
 being none, he noted that Motion 2, to recommend confirmation of              
 Grant Miller, passed.                                                         
                                                                               
 Number 0175                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ON moved that the name of Dan Coffey be reported            
 out of committee with a recommendation that he be confirmed to the            
 Board of Fisheries.  He recommended a "no" vote.                              
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N noted that was Motion 3.                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N objected.                                                 
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N asked if there was discussion and requested a              
 roll call vote.  Voting for the motion to recommend confirmation of           
 Dan Coffey were Representatives Ogan, Moses and Austerman.  Voting            
 against it were Representatives Davis and Elton.  So, the motion              
 passed, 3-2.                                                                  
                                                                               
 Number 0193                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ON moved that the committee forward the three               
 names to the full body with the attached motions.                             
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S objected and suggested Mr. Miller, at least,             
 had already been addressed.                                                   
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N explained that the committee forwarded its                 
 recommendations to the full body.  The motions that had passed or             
 failed would be attached as part of the record and forwarded, as              
 well.                                                                         
                                                                               
 Number 0208                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ON withdrew his motion and restated it.  He moved           
 that the committee forward to the full body its recommendations on            
 the three nominees.                                                           
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S stated his votes were no reflection on how he            
 might vote on the floor.  He said he had thought these motions                
 would take the place of any others.                                           
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N indicated that since Representative Davis did             
 not understand what he was voting on, he wanted to vote again.                
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N clarified that the motions were a matter of                
 statement.                                                                    
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E DAVIS indicated that was not his understanding.                
                                                                               
 Number 0251                                                                   
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N noted that the motion to forward the                       
 recommendations still stood.  He asked whether Representative Ogan            
 was comfortable with his votes on the motions.                                
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E OGAN replied, "I'm comfortable with my votes.  I'm             
 not comfortable with the fact that we didn't vote on Miller, and I            
 regret that I didn't object to the motion."  He said he wanted to             
 do it uniformly.                                                              
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ON withdrew his motion.  He then moved to rescind           
 the action on Motion 2, regarding Grant Miller.  There being no               
 objection, it was so ordered.                                                 
                                                                               
 C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N noted that the original Motion 2 was before the            
 committee.  He asked if there was discussion and requested a roll             
 call vote.  Voting for the motion to recommend confirmation of                
 Grant Miller were Representatives Elton, Davis, Moses and                     
 Austerman.  Voting against the motion was Representative Ogan.  So,           
 it passed, 4-1.                                                               
                                                                               
 Number 0277                                                                   
                                                                               
 REPRESENTATIVE ELTON made a motion to forward the recommendations             
 to the joint session with the attached motions.  There being no               
 objection, the names of Grant Miller, Dan Coffey and Virgil                   
 Umphenour were forwarded with the attached motions reflecting the             
 committee's opinions.                                                         
                                                                               
 ADJOURNMENT                                                                   
                                                                               
 There being no further business to conduct, CHAIRMAN AUSTERMAN                
 thanked the members and adjourned the House Special Committee on              
 Fisheries meeting at 10:14 a.m.
